Sergio Sánchez Shaw was born in Valladolid, where he took his first steps as an actor. He graduated in Dramatic Art from the School for the Dramatic Arts in this city, and then moved to Barcelona and, lastly, to Madrid, to pursue his dream of acting. He started appearing in a number of TV shows, including
Hospital Central (2000) or
Estudio 1 (1965), and leading the cast of short films such as
Escorzo (2005),
Evaluación Final (2011) and
De-mente (2016). But above all else, he's a man of stage. He was a member of the National Dramatic Center of Spain for several years, and performed under the order of well-known Spanish directors
Gerardo Vera and
Miguel Narros.
